Snowflake: Revolutionizing Data Management and Analytics
In the dynamic realm of data analytics and storage,
Snowflake has become a revolutionary discovery. Its cloud-native architecture
has redefined how organizations manage, analyze, and share their data. This article
delves into Snowflake's description, highlights its benefits, outlines the
differences it offers compared to traditional solutions, addresses its challenges,
and provides a conclusion on its transformative potential.
Description: What is Snowflake?
Snowflake is a cloud-based data platform that combines the
power of a data warehouse, data lake, and data-sharing ecosystem. Built to run
entirely in the cloud, Snowflake is designed to handle large-scale data storage
and enable high-performance analytics.
Users can increase resources independently because to its
special architecture, which divides computation and storage. This flexibility,
coupled with support for multiple cloud providers (AWS, Azure, and Google
Cloud), has positioned Snowflake as a leader in modern data solutions.
Benefits: Why Snowflake Stands Out
Snowflake offers several advantages that set it apart from
traditional and even some modern data solutions:
1.
Scalability
Snowflake’s elastic nature allows organizations to scale
resources up or down based on demand, ensuring optimal performance without
incurring unnecessary costs.
2. Ease of Use
The platform provides a user-friendly interface and
SQL-based querying, making it accessible for users with varying technical
expertise.
3. Seamless Data
Sharing
Snowflake’s data-sharing capabilities enable secure and
real-time collaboration between teams, organizations, and partners.
4. Cost Efficiency
With its pay-as-you-go model, Snowflake allows businesses to
optimize spending by only paying for the storage and compute they use.
5. Multi-Cloud Compatibility
Its ability to operate across major cloud platforms ensures
flexibility and avoids vendor lock-in, a significant advantage for businesses
with diverse infrastructures.
Difference: Snowflake vs. Traditional Data Solutions
| Feature | Traditional Data Warehouses | Snowflake |
|Infrastructure| On-premises or hybrid solutions |
Cloud-native with multi-cloud support |
| Scalability | Limited by physical hardware | Infinite
scaling via cloud resources |
| Data Sharing | Complex and often delayed | Real-time and
seamless |
| Cost Model | High upfront and operational costs |
Pay-as-you-go with no hardware investments |
| Performance| Bottlenecks due to coupled compute and
storage | Independent scaling of compute and storage |
Challenges: Potential Limitations of Snowflake
While Snowflake provides ground breaking solutions, it does
face certain challenges:
1. Learning Curve
For organizations transitioning from traditional systems,
adapting to Snowflake’s architecture and features may require time and
training.
2. Cost Management
Although cost-efficient, improper resource management can lead
to unexpected expenses, especially in large-scale deployments.
3. Vendor Dependency
While Snowflake avoids vendor lock-in with multi-cloud
compatibility, organizations remain dependent on its proprietary ecosystem for
specific functionalities.
4. Data Privacy
Concerns
Storing sensitive data in the cloud raises questions about
compliance and privacy, particularly in highly regulated industries.
Conclusion: Snowflake's Transformative Role
Snowflake has undoubtedly revolutionized the data storage
and analytics landscape, offering unmatched flexibility, scalability, and ease
of use. Its ability to integrate seamlessly with existing cloud infrastructures
and support real-time collaboration makes it a vital tool for modern businesses.
However, like any technology, its success depends on
thoughtful implementation and management. Organizations must address challenges
like cost control and data security to fully harness its potential.
In conclusion, Snowflake is more than a data platform; it’s
a transformative solution empowering businesses to unlock the full potential of
their data, driving smarter decisions and fostering innovation in the digital
era.
Would you like this article customized for a specific
industry or audience?